The major operational event today was not a routing bug. It was a prolonged GitHub connectivity outage:
- repeated
HTTP send failedretries againsthttps://api.github.com/user - global
github:5xxcircuit breaker openings - repeated
project backends unavailable, retrying: GitHub unreachable for all configured projects (2 project(s)) - recovery at 2026-07-24T23:51:32Z, when both
gabrielkoerich/orchandgabrielkoerich/beanreconnected and normal routing resumed
That behavior looks operationally correct:
- the circuit breaker persisted across restarts
- non-critical work backed off instead of thrashing
- routing resumed immediately once connectivity returned
- the daily review and evening retrospective jobs were created and dispatched right after recovery
So this was a real incident, but the evidence points to transient upstream/network unavailability rather than a missing orch safeguard.
